Shameless “friend” stole purse from woman while socializing with her

GeneralShameless “friend” stole purse from woman while socializing with her

COROZAL TOWN–A woman has been detained by police, pending charges of theft, after she was captured on camera stealing the purse of Sabrina Martinez, 33, a domestic of San Narciso, Corozal District, while they were socializing at a bar in Corozal Town.

The incident occurred at about 7:00 Tuesday evening, December 30, at a bar on 5th Avenue in Corozal Town.

Martinez told police that she, the friend and her nephew were socializing at Perfect Restaurant when she left her purse with the friend for safekeeping while she became engaged in a conversation with another acquaintance of hers.

Martinez reported that she ordered drinks from the bar and when she went for her purse from the friend to pay for the drinks, the friend and her purse were nowhere to be found.

She began a search in the restaurant for her purse and found it on a table near the bathroom, but all she had in the purse had been stolen, including $80.

The owner of the restaurant immediately began to review the security camera tapes in the restaurant, and the thief, the so-called friend of Martinez, was seen taking away the purse, stealing its contents and leaving the restaurant.

Police later found the woman and arrested her on a charge of theft.

Amandala was informed, however, that Martinez will not press charges against her purported friend, and that they had come to some agreement.
